This was very bad for USC, but the really alarming part of Saturday’s loss to Notre Dame was that you could see it coming even if you didn’t predict it would happen.

Notre Dame’s offense was not that impressive. The Irish gained only 253 yards against an Alex Grinch-coached defense. If you had been told before the game that USC would give up only 253 yards, you probably would have felt really good about the Trojans’ chances.

Everything else, however, collapsed for this team. Caleb Williams was bad. The receivers were bad. The offensive line was bad. The special teams were bad. USC handed Notre Dame points and field position and leverage, over and over again.

Lincoln Riley has a problem. Correction: He has a lot of problems.
